Zoho 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us 8.0/8.1 information disclosure

Details
A vulnerability was found in Zoho 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us and classified as problematic. This issue affects some unknown processing.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a information disclosure v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-200. The product exposes sensitive information to an actor that is not explicitly authorized to have access to that information. Impacted is confidentiality. The summary by CVE is:
ZOHO 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us (SDP) before 9.0 build 9031 allows remote authenticated users to obtain sensitive ticket information via a (1) getTicketData action to servlet/AJaxServlet or a direct request to (2) swf/flashreport.swf, (3) reports/flash/details.jsp, or (4) reports/CreateReportTable.jsp.
The weakness was disclosed 02/04/2015 by Muhammad Ahmed Siddiqui (Website). The advisory is shared at securityfocus.com.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2015-1480 since 02/04/2015.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be initiated remotely. Required for exploitation is a simple authentication. Technical details are unknown but a public exploit is available.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1592 for this issue.
A public exploit has been developed by Rewterz - Research Group and been published even before and not after the advisory. The exploit is available at exploit-db.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ept. The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 9 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$0-$5k.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 115178 (ZOHO 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us SQL Injection and Information Disclosure Vulnerability).
Upgrading to version 9.0 eliminates this vulnerability. Furthermore it is possible to detect and prevent this kind of attack with TippingPoint and the filter 19842.
